Welcome to Warrington House, a magnificent Georgian residence nestled in the enchanting village of Thornton-le-Dale. This grand property is ideally situated in the heart of the village, just a few steps away from charming cafes..
Ground Floor:
Living/dining room: Freeview Smart TV, Woodburner
Kitchen: Breakfast Bar, Electric Oven, Electric Hob, Microwave, Fridge/Freezer, Dishwasher, Coffee Machine
Utility Room: Washing Machine, Toilet
Separate Toilet 1.
First Floor:
Bedroom 1: Kingsize (5ft) Bed, Freeview TV, Dressing Area
Ensuite: Bath With Shower Over, Toilet
Bedroom 2: Four Poster Kingsize (5ft) Bed, Single (3ft) Bed, Freeview TV
Ensuite: Cubicle Shower, Toilet
Separate Toilet 2.
Second Floor:
Bedroom 3: Kingsize (5ft) Bed, TV
Ensuite: Bath, Cubicle Shower, Toilet
Bedroom 4: Super Kingsize (6ft) Bed, Sofa Bed (Double), Smart TV
Ensuite: Cubicle Shower, Toilet.
Gas central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Welcome pack. Enclosed back garden. On road parking. No smoking.. Set over three floors, Warrington House offers an abundance of space, perfect for big family get-togethers. As you enter the house, there is an open-plan living room, providing a bright and inviting space for relaxation. Adjacent to the living room is a spacious dining area, perfect for meals shared with loved ones. The modern kitchen, complete with integrated appliances and a convenient breakfast bar, overlooks the enclosed patio at the rear.. The ground floor also features a utility room, a cloak, although workmen like its houses a Belfast sink and Toilet, adding convenience to your stay. Venturing up to the first floor, there are two bedrooms, one king bedroom with a full bathroom and dressing room, as well as a family bedroom with a king-size four-poster and a single bed. The family room has an en-suite shower, plus there is a separate toilet.
On the second floor, you have two bedrooms, one with a super king bed with an en-suite shower. This large room also has a comfortable sofa bed. On this floor is a double with an en-suite full bathroom. Thornton-le-Dale is known for its idyllic beauty and quaint atmosphere, with a delightful array of cafes, shops, and a chocolatier, all within a short stroll from the property. Thornton le Dale is a haven for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ts, as it is surrounded by the breathtaking landscapes of the North York Moors National Park. This stunning national park is a treasure trove of rolling hills, ancient woodlands, and picturesque dales, providing ample opportunities for hiking, cycling, and exploration.
For those seeking the allure of the nearby coastline, Warrington House is perfectly situated to access the stunning beaches and seaside towns of North Yorkshire. Rugged cliffs, golden sands, and charming fishing villages await. Families can also enjoy an array of attractions nearby, from the fascinating Eden Camp to the thrilling Flamingo Land Theme Park and Zoo. There is something for everyone to enjoy. Beach is 15 miles.

Well equipped property with some lovely rooms downstairs. Spacious bedrooms all with en suite facilities and televisions. The downside during our stay in February was how cold it was throughout the property. You can turn up the heating from the preset 18°C to 20°C but the thermostat is upstairs so downstairs stays cold. Some of the bathrooms have no heat source so they were uncomfortably cold during our stay.

Downstairs is 5 star with fabulous kitchen, plenty of crockery, cutlery and glasses, 2 lovely seating areas, log burner and great big dining table. Upstairs, not so much and I only mention this because the house is listed as luxury. It’s evident that it used to be run as a guest house, it's neat and clean but has been tidied up on a budget. All the showers are electric and they had no water pressure on a warm setting in January when the water going in was so cold. Showering was a real ordeal. The bed was very comfortable though, with lovely bedding. Just to say as well, although the house is dog-friendly, there are dire warnings of a £60 cleaning fee if any evidence of dog is found upstairs. Dogs are not allowed upstairs, or to be left unattended (fair enough - but then you are forced to leave them unattended downstairs all night). I wish I had read the reviews for the sister cottage where poor Dave cried because he couldn’t understand why he had to be left downstairs – we had the same problem. We were also paranoid of carrying dog hair upstairs on our clothes!
